What does a treadmill cost?
Treadmills can be a great exercise machine for those who want to work out at home. They are available at various price points depending on their functionality as well as construction materials and added features. Treadmills are classified as entry-level, midrange, and high-end. Additionally, they can be classified into folding, manual and under-desk varieties. The type and amount of warranty provided by the manufacturer has significant impact on the price of the treadmill as well.
In general, budget treadmills home are less expensive than mid-range and high-end models. When comparing treadmills be sure to check their motor horsepower (or CPH), which is the amount of power the treadmill's motor can produce continuously. The treadmills with a higher CPH are more durable and last longer than ones with lower CPH.

What type of treadmill should I buy?
There are several factors to take into consideration when purchasing a treadmill, regardless of whether it's for your home gym or commercial. First, you must consider the frequency you'll be using the treadmill. You could save money if plan to use the treadmill for occasional times for instance during bad weather conditions or as an additional to your outdoor exercise. If you intend to run many miles, on the other hand you'll require a bigger motor and a more robust frame specifically designed for running and able to sustain the speed of a high-level.
The other thing to think about is whether you plan on using the treadmill for jogging, walking or both. If you're a devoted athlete, you'll need to look for a treadmill with continuous horsepower (CHP) that can handle the greater demands of a runner. Ideally, you'll need at minimum 3.0 CHP. A walk-specific treadmill however, can be used as walking or jogging and could only require 1.5 CHP.
It's also important to find the treadmill that has an easy-to-change, clear display. Fagin states that you don't want your neck to be strained upwards or downwards in order to see your results. "Make sure your head is at an eye level that's comfortable."
Other features to think about include the treadmill's weight limit, incline range, and maximum speed.
